Washington Redskins Sign Robert Griffin III
Published at(NEW YORK) — The RG3 era can officially begin in Washington. The Redskins signed rookie quarterback Robert Griffin III on Wednesday to a four-year contract, a source told ESPN NFL Insider Adam Schefter.
“Well people….It’s Time to go to Work!!! Off the unemployment line and oh yea HTTR!!!!” Griffin tweeted early Wednesday morning.
Griffin will receive $21.1 million guaranteed, according to league sources, and will start.
“He’s the starter. Period,” Washington Redskins head coach Mike Shanahan said.
Washington will kick off their 2012 season on the road against the New Orleans Saints on September 9. Redskins’ fans will get their first look at Griffin III in preseason on August 9 against Buffalo.
